Output 81af587d3ad2dc4d6ca35eada1041bc7d6f3bd7c14920ef037df4504902a4e2e:0

value
94423323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f42ff989847f2ae28b8a5ea48c159213b9a8a0 OP_EQUAL
address
34sqRWByKHnmMMPHKJkB4xjKLEntS6KcBi
transaction
81af587d3ad2dc4d6ca35eada1041bc7d6f3bd7c14920ef037df4504902a4e2e
confirmations
398271
spent
true